Understanding Muscle Car Air Intake Systems: The Role of V8 Engines
Muscle cars, known for their raw power and distinctive sound, often come equipped with V8 engines that demand specific attention when it comes to air intake systems. These high-performance engines require a steady supply of cool, dense air to maintain optimal combustion, which is where muscle car air intake systems come into play.
V8 muscle cars are renowned for their ability to produce immense torque and horsepower, and the right air intake system can enhance this performance further. By allowing more air to enter the engine, these systems contribute to improved throttle response, better fuel efficiency, and a more robust overall performance, making them a popular modification choice among enthusiasts.
Types of Air Intake Systems for Optimal Performance
In the realm of muscle car modifications, the air intake system plays a pivotal role in unlocking the full potential of a V8 engine. The primary goal is to maximize airflow, ensuring an efficient combustion process that translates into enhanced performance. Traditional mass-air flow (MAF) sensors, while reliable, may not be as responsive to rapid changes in air pressure, which can limit peak power output. Here’s where high-flow air intake systems come into play.
These systems often incorporate dry filter designs, eliminating the need for oil to support the filter media, allowing for a greater flow capacity. Some advanced muscle car air intake systems feature ram air technology, utilizing the vehicle’s forward motion to create vacuum, drawing in cold, dense air from outside the engine bay. This direct-air intake method can significantly boost power figures, especially at high RPMs, making it a popular choice among enthusiasts seeking that extra horsepower for their V8-powered rides.
Customization and Upgrades: Enhancing Your Muscle Car's Breath
Muscle cars with their powerful V8 engines are iconic, but enhancing their performance is a common desire among enthusiasts. One effective way to achieve this is through custom air intake systems. These modifications allow for better airflow, enabling the engine to breathe more efficiently. By optimizing the route of incoming air, you can increase power and torque, making your muscle car feel more responsive.
Upgrading the air intake system involves careful consideration of components like cold air intakes, filters, and pipe configurations. Customizing these elements ensures a seamless fit and allows for precise tuning to match your driving preferences. Many enthusiasts choose unique designs, often featuring cold air intakes mounted in distinctive locations, enhancing both performance and aesthetics.
